What Is An Infant Incubator (Transport)?
An Infant Incubator (Transport) is a specialized, portable medical device designed to provide a controlled and stable environment for critically ill or premature newborns during transit. Unlike stationary incubators found in neonatal intensive care units (NICUs), transport incubators are built for mobility, ensuring the infant's vital physiological parameters are maintained during transfers between healthcare facilities, within a hospital (e.g., from delivery room to NICU), or for inter-facility transfers. They are engineered to withstand the rigors of transportation while prioritizing patient safety and thermoregulation.
- Primary Function: To provide a safe and stable microenvironment for neonates requiring temperature regulation, humidity control, and oxygen administration while on the move.
- Key Clinical Applications:
- Neonatal Resuscitation and Stabilization: Facilitating immediate care for newborns requiring stabilization following birth, particularly those born prematurely or with respiratory distress, before reaching a permanent NICU bed.
- Inter-facility Transfers: Ensuring continuous, optimal care for infants being moved from a referring hospital to a higher-level facility with specialized neonatal services.
- Intra-facility Transport: Safely transporting neonates between departments within a hospital, such as from the delivery suite, operating room, or emergency department to the NICU.
- Emergency Medical Services (EMS): Providing a controlled environment for newborns requiring transport by ambulance, maintaining critical care conditions en route.
- Temperature Regulation: Maintaining a precise and stable body temperature for neonates, crucial for preventing hypothermia or hyperthermia, both of which can have severe consequences.
- Humidity Control: Providing a humidified atmosphere to prevent insensible water loss and maintain skin integrity in vulnerable infants.
- Oxygen Administration: Delivering supplemental oxygen as needed to support respiratory function, with controlled flow rates and concentrations.
- Monitoring Capabilities: Often integrated with or designed to accommodate vital sign monitoring equipment (e.g., pulse oximetry, ECG, blood pressure) for real-time assessment during transit.
Who Needs Infant Incubators (Transport) In Namibia?
In Namibia, the critical need for infant transport incubators spans a range of healthcare facilities and departments, ensuring the safe and stable transfer of vulnerable newborns across distances. These specialized units are essential for maintaining the optimal physiological environment for neonates during transit, preventing adverse outcomes.
- Tertiary and Referral Hospitals: Facilities like the Windhoek Central Hospital and other major regional hospitals require transport incubators for intra-facility transfers (e.g., from the Neonatal Intensive Care Unit (NICU) to imaging departments or operating rooms) and for inter-facility transfers to specialized units within the hospital or to other higher-level care centers for complex cases.
- District and Regional Hospitals: These hospitals, serving broader populations, are crucial for initial stabilization. Transport incubators are vital for transferring neonates with emergent needs to tertiary centers when local resources are insufficient. They also facilitate transfers between district facilities for specialized care.
- Smaller Clinics and Health Centers: While these facilities may not have the resources for advanced neonatal care, they are often the first point of contact. Transport incubators are essential for safely transferring critically ill newborns from these smaller units to the nearest hospital capable of providing a higher level of care.
- Maternity Wards and Neonatal Intensive Care Units (NICUs): Within hospitals, these departments are primary users. Transport incubators are indispensable for moving neonates to and from the NICU, delivery rooms, and other diagnostic or treatment areas, minimizing environmental stress and physiological compromise.
- Emergency Medical Services (EMS) and Ambulance Services: Namibian EMS providers play a pivotal role in pre-hospital care. Equipped with transport incubators, they can provide critical life support and temperature regulation for newborns from the moment of birth or discovery in the field, ensuring a stable handover to hospital care.
- Specialized Pediatric and Neonatal Transport Teams: As Namibia develops more advanced healthcare services, dedicated mobile neonatal transport teams will increasingly rely on state-of-the-art transport incubators to manage complex retrievals and transfers across the country.

How Much Is An Infant Incubator (Transport) In Namibia?
The cost of infant transport incubators in Namibia can vary significantly based on several factors, including brand, features, technological sophistication, and the supplier. For a new, high-quality transport incubator, you can expect to invest in the range of N$150,000 to N$500,000 or more. This price bracket typically covers units with advanced temperature and humidity control, integrated monitoring systems (including vital signs), and robust shock absorption for safe transit. Pre-owned or refurbished units, while potentially offering a lower entry point, can range from N$70,000 to N$250,000, but it's crucial to ensure they have been thoroughly inspected and certified for reliable performance.
Factors influencing the final price include the availability of specific accessories, warranty coverage, and any associated training or installation services. It is advisable to obtain detailed quotes from multiple reputable medical equipment suppliers operating within Namibia or those with established distribution networks to ensure you are getting competitive pricing and the best value for your institution's needs.
